Austentatious is an improvised Jane Austen novel, currently on a UK tour, which will be performed at Riverfront Theatre, from 8pm, on Friday.

Starring the country's quickest comic performers, each show will be a unique 'lost' Jane Austen novel, based on a title suggested by the audience.

Previous 'lost' works include: Sixth Sense & Sensibility, Double 0 Darcy, and Mansfield Shark, with each presenting a riveting story with rounded characters, delicate plotting, and real drama.

Austentatious said: "We are thrilled to be travelling the length and breadth of the country, rediscovering the lost classics Austen wrote and promptly forgot about.

"We love and admire Jane’s works and the public deserve an intimate acquaintance with them, particularly the very prescient ones about Donald Trump."

The cast is comprised of acclaimed comedy talent: Cariad Lloyd, Rachel Parris, Joseph Morpurgo, Amy Cooke-Hodgson, Andrew Hunter Murray, Graham Dickson, Charlotte Gittins, and Daniel Nils Roberts.

Each unique show will star a varying line-up of fix or six cast members.
